Polyurethane Defoamer is a type of additive employed to minimize foam formation during production processes, particularly in the manufacturing of polyurethane foams and coatings. This defoamer works by destabilizing the foam structure, allowing for quicker collapse and preventing foam buildup that can interfere with production efficiency. Known for its versatility, Polyurethane Defoamer can be applied in various industries, including coatings, adhesives, textiles, and more.
One of the primary benefits of using Polyurethane Defoamer is the improvement in product quality. Foam entrapment can lead to defects in the final product, affecting its appearance, texture, and overall performance. By effectively reducing foam, this defoamer ensures a smoother and more consistent end product. Manufacturers can achieve better characteristics, such as improved durability and surface finish, making Polyurethane Defoamer essential in industries where quality is paramount.
Another significant advantage of utilizing Polyurethane Defoamer is the boost in operational efficiency. Excessive foam can disrupt processes, leading to production delays and increased waste. By incorporating this defoamer into your operations, you minimize foam-related interruptions, allowing for smoother production flows. This not only saves time but also reduces the need for manual interventions to control foam levels, optimizing overall productivity.

Polyurethane Defoamer boasts exceptional versatility, making it suitable for a wide range of applications. Whether you’re working with water-based or solvent-based systems, this defoamer adapts effectively to diverse formulations. It can be utilized in paints, varnishes, and adhesives, as well as in the production of polyurethane foams. This versatility makes Polyurethane Defoamer a valuable addition to your chemical toolkit, capable of addressing foam issues across multiple processes.
Investing in Polyurethane Defoamer can lead to significant cost savings in production. By effectively managing foam, companies can reduce product waste and minimize the need for rework due to defects. Additionally, operational efficiency improvements can lead to reduced labor costs related to monitoring and controlling foam levels. The minimal usage required for effective foam control further enhances its cost-effectiveness. Ultimately, the right defoamer can contribute to a healthier bottom line.
In today’s eco-conscious market, the demand for environmentally friendly products is on the rise. Many formulations of Polyurethane Defoamer are designed with sustainability in mind. Manufacturers are increasingly developing defoamers that contain fewer volatile organic compounds (VOCs) and are safe for the environment. By choosing such environmentally friendly options, companies not only adhere to regulatory standards but also demonstrate a commitment to sustainable practices.
